Transaction 43e8908a6c9b1e6a079dfa4b73242424767390e3dbda15952c1905df885b144c

1 Input
2 Outputs
  • 43e8908a6c9b1e6a079dfa4b73242424767390e3dbda15952c1905df885b144c:0
  • value  23039695
    address  16X9V5AySZ7LSiqAQ4GkVixxMMiWT4hTxF
  • 43e8908a6c9b1e6a079dfa4b73242424767390e3dbda15952c1905df885b144c:1
  • value  1675000
    address  3P1a2AV2mAfrJDeANP7wKW89nEisAYuHJy